Berlin's VC Cherry Ventures raises $500M fund to back companies at Series B and beyond

Berlin-based VC firm Cherry Ventures has raised $500 million for its fifth fund. The money is split between its Early Stage fund and an opportunity fund to back companies at Series B and beyond. The goal is to help founders build Europe’s first trillion-dollar company.

  • Founded in 2013 by Christian Meermann, Daniel Glasner, and Filip Felician Dames, Cherry Ventures is a venture capital firm with offices in Berlin, London, and Stockholm. 
  • The firm invests in early-stage companies led by founders tackling critical societal, environmental, and business challenges. To date, the firm has backed over 130 companies, including FlixBus, Auto1, Juni, Moss, and Carbo Culture.

"We have all the right ingredients: world-class talent, research depth in critical technologies, and thriving tech hubs — but our culture of innovation must change. With new world leaders in power and strong mandates for the tech sector, it’s imperative that Europe takes charge of its own destiny in the global tech race," Cherry's team explains in the announcement.

  • Cherry V plans to divide the $500 million fund between an Early Stage fund and an opportunity fund, which will support promising companies at Series B and beyond.
  • The fresh fund saw support from prominent investors, including Ilkka Paananen, Founder of Supercell, Miki Kuusi, Founder of Wolt, and Jochen Engert, Founder of FlixBus, as well as other key figures in the global tech ecosystem. 

"Cherry V is a commitment to patience and persistence, enabling founders to create lasting value over time. Partnering with Cherry at the early stage significantly increases your chance of success: over 80% of our seed founders graduate to Series A," Cherry's team says.
